In 2020-2021, 29,793 people earned their degree in general mathematics, making the major the 26th most popular in the United States.

Across the Southwest region, there were 2,845 general mathematics gra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 1,971 general mathematics graduates with average earnings and debt of $40,112 and $26,227 respectively.

This year’s “Most Well Attended Mathematical Sciences Major in the Southwest Region for a Bachelor’s” ranking looked at 99 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in general mathematics. This ranking identifies schools that graduate the most students in general mathematics.
